Shinjini Chattopadhyay is a Marion L. Brittain Postdoctoral Fellow at the Georgia Institute of Technology, GA, US. She completed her PhD at the Department of English, University of Notre Dame, IN, US, with minors in Irish Studies and Gender Studies. She completed her MPhil and MA in English Literature from Jadavpur University, India. She works on British and Irish modernisms and global Anglophone literatures. Her monograph-in-progress, Plurabilities of the City, investigates the construction of metropolitan cosmopolitanism in modernist and contemporary novels. Her articles have been published or are forthcoming in James Joyce Quarterly, European Joyce Studies, Joyce Studies in Italy, and Modernism/Modernity Print+.
